International Conference on Gerontechnology (Online Conference)
The theme of the conference: Achieving excellence in elderly care through gerontechnology
The world's population is aging rapidly and Gerontechnology becomes the fresh hope of the world to tackle the aging challenges. Sponsored by Professional Services Advancement Support Scheme, International Conference on Gerontechnology will be rescheduled to take place online from 25-27 November 2020 (Wed to Friday)
To promote the understanding of gerontechnology among the industry and the public, and enhancing the quality of life and independence of the elderly, the 3-day conference will deliver 13 amazing presentations. It brings together 5 renowned scholars from The United States, Canada, and Southeast Asia and 8 local professionals to share their expertise on the development of gerontechnology, application in elderly care, and best practice case studies. Besides, the conference also features several exhibiting booths that showcase cutting edge technology products.
